Saving money as a teen is hard but not impossible.

Explanation:

When you have friends who are out buying new clothes and going on weekends trips. But it's not impossible.

Here's how teens can save :

1. Start saving account.

2.Separate spending money from saving

3.Keep track on your purchases

4.Ask your parents

5.Use your student ID

6.Get a summer job
